Position Summary
The English Language Learner (ELL) Teacher serves as an instructional partner and advocate for multilingual learners delivering high-quality language-focused instruction that accelerates English language development while ensuring meaningful access to grade-level content.
This role blends Tier 1 push-in support with Tier 2 targeted small-group or pull-out instruction emphasizing collaboration with classroom teachers alignment to WIDA standards and the use of research-based instructional practices. The ELL Teacher plays a critical role in building students academic language literacy skills and confidence as learners and community members.
Key Responsibilities
Tier 1 Instructional Support (Push-In)
- Collaborate with general education teachers to co-plan and deliver language supports aligned to Oklahoma Academic Standards and grade-level content
- Provide in-class scaffolding to support listening speaking reading and writing across content areas
- Model and reinforce effective instructional strategies for multilingual learners including language objectives sentence frames structured academic talk and visual supports
- Use WIDA Can Do Descriptors and English Language Development (ELD) standards to differentiate instruction based on English proficiency levels
- Support teachers in adapting lessons assessments and instructional materials to ensure equitable access for English learners
- Promote inclusive classroom environments that affirm linguistic and cultural diversity
Tier 2 Instructional Support (Pull-Out & Small Group)
- Design and deliver targeted small-group or pull-out instruction based on WIDA data MAP Growth classroom assessments and progress-monitoring tools
- Provide explicit instruction in academic vocabulary grammar phonological awareness reading comprehension and writing structures as appropriate
- Implement evidence-based intervention strategies for students requiring additional language development support
- Monitor student progress toward English proficiency goals and adjust intervention plans accordingly
- Maintain documentation related to services progress monitoring and instructional outcomes
